A violation with the self-dealing rules or perhaps the acquisition of the prohibited asset triggers extreme and immediate tax effects for your IRA owner. The principal result is the speedy disqualification of the entire IRA, powerful as of the main day of the 12 months where the violation occurred. The entire truthful market place value of the account is then addressed as a completely taxable distribution to the IRA proprietor in that calendar year.

Disqualified Folks A disqualified particular person refers to somebody with whom a SDIRA simply cannot spot investment money. These involve the SDIRA proprietor’s fiduciary or members of the family which include partner, ancestor, child, and spouse’s boy or girl.
